Minecraft Minecoins are the official virtual currency used in Minecraft’s Bedrock Edition, including the Windows 10 Edition. They enable players to purchase digital content from the Minecraft Marketplace, such as skin packs, texture packs, and custom worlds. You can acquire Minecoins either by purchasing them directly in the game or by redeeming gift cards that you buy online or at retail stores.
